18 ROMAN CLOSE is a midsized extended detached house of 96m², built sometime between 1967 and 1975, which could now be worth an estimated £200,785. It was last sold for £170,000 in July 2020, which was around 34% below the average July 2020 detached price in the North Kesteven local authority area. The most recent EPC inspection was July 2014, where the current energy rating was E, and the potential energy rating was C.

What might 18 ROMAN CLOSE be worth now?

18 ROMAN CLOSE might now be worth an estimated £200,785.

This is based on house price inflation of 18.1%, between July 2020 and February 2025, for detached houses, in the North Kesteven local authority area, as calculated by the Office for National Statistics and published in their UK House Price Index (HPI).

The 18.1% inflationary increase is applied to the most recent sale price for 18 ROMAN CLOSE of £170,000 on 10th July 2020. For the value to have increased from £170,000 to £200,785 over the five years and five months to February 2025, the following assumptions must hold true:

  • The value of 18 ROMAN CLOSE has moved in line with the HPI for detached houses in the North Kesteven local authority area.
  • The July 2020 sale price of £170,000 represented a fair market value for the property.
  • The size, condition, and specification of 18 ROMAN CLOSE has not materially changed since July 2020.

18 ROMAN CLOSE: Plot and Title Map

18 ROMAN CLOSE sits on a plot of roughly 0.101 of an acre, or 410m². The below map shows the location of 18 ROMAN CLOSE, an approximate outline of the building(s), and the indicative extent of the property. The plot extent is a Land Registry INSPIRE Index Polygon, and it is important to note that a title may include more than one polygon, whereas only one polygon is shown on the map (the polygon which intersects with the position of 18 ROMAN CLOSE). The full extent of the land contained in any registered title can only be identified from the individual title plan. The maps on this page should not be relied upon to establish the extent of a title.
